About DIC: Dubai Internet City (DIC) is the Middle East's largest technology business community, home to global companies including Google, Microsoft, LinkedIn, and Meta. Established in 2000, DIC provides office space and licensing for IT, software development, digital services, and telecommunications companies. Its ecosystem connects tech talent with enterprise clients across the region.
Requirements
Typical Documents Required
- Passport copy (valid for at least 6 months)
- Passport-sized photograph
- Completed application form
- Business plan or activity description
- Proof of address (home country)
- Bank reference letter (for some activities)
- NOC from current sponsor (if UAE resident)
- Professional qualifications (for regulated activities)
